Hurry Up and Wait If the colossal statue was going to be ready to present to the United States in time for the Centennial, there wasn't a minute to lose. However, the Franco-Prussian War (also known as the Franco-German War) raged from July 19, 1870, to May 10, 1871, which delayed all further progress on the project.

Construction & Installation Facts & Figures Repair Concerns Repair Details Reclothed Lady Through one hundred years of biting sea winds, driving rains and beating sun, the copper skin of the Statue of Liberty not only has grown more beautiful but also has remained virtually intact.

The Statue of Liberty (Officially the "Liberty Enlightening the World", by Frederic Auguste Bartoldi) has a copper shell with an average thickness of 2.3 mm. The statue is about 50 meters high, the weight of copper is about 80 tons.

Statue of Liberty Museum. The Statue of Liberty Museum was completed in 2019. It was built as a separate entity from the Statue and the pedestal in order to reduce the traffic to the premises. The museum, which occupies about 26,000 square feet, contains the original torch of the Statue of Liberty. It cost about $70 million to construct.

The Statue of Liberty was gifted to the United States of America by the French in 1886, as a symbol of friendship and in celebration of the centennial of the signing of the US Declaration of Independence.
